Problem Definition

Large-scale commercial and infrastructure projects—airport terminals, railway stations, shopping malls, and logistics warehouses—demand flooring materials that withstand high foot traffic, heavy loads, extreme temperatures, and repeated cleaning. Inconsistent tile quality can cause warping, cracking, fading, and staining, leading to costly delays and repairs. Moreover, project owners often struggle with suppliers that lack the production capacity, logistical reach, or after-sales infrastructure to support multinational construction timelines.

Industry Background

The global ceramic and porcelain tiles market was valued at USD 423.90 billion in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 845.80 billion by 2034 (Custom Market Insights). In Russia, the ceramic tiles market reached USD 3.2 billion in 2024, while Uzbekistan imported USD 125 million of ceramic products, with China as the top supplier at USD 75.1 million (OEC). Southeast Asia’s market is approximately USD 11.5 billion, driven by tourism and infrastructure growth (Mordor Intelligence). These statistics underscore the demand for reliable commercial tile solutions across Central Asia, Eastern Europe, and Southeast Asia.

Porcelain tiles for commercial use are classified under ISO 13006 / EN 14411 (Group BIa) with water absorption ≤ 0.5%. High-traffic public areas like airports and railway stations require a slip resistance rating of R10 or R11 per DIN 51130. Frost resistance is tested under ISO 10545-12, requiring at least 100 freeze-thaw cycles.

Detailed Solution: ALL KING Ceramics’ Commercial Tile Offering

ALL KING Ceramics produces high-performance porcelain tiles in key formats including 60x120cm, 75x150cm, 80x80cm, 100x100cm, and 60x60cm. Their flagship 60x120cm porcelain tiles are available in Marble and Travertine series, with technical specifications: thickness 9.0–10.5 mm, water absorption < 0.5% (vitrified), abrasion resistance PEI 4/5, Mohs hardness 6–7, breaking strength ≥ 1300 N, and modulus of rupture ≥ 35 MPa. These parameters exceed typical requirements for commercial centers, luxury hotels, transit hubs, and corporate offices.

Use Cases

  • Airport Terminals & Railway Stations: Large-format porcelain slabs (75x150cm, 100x100cm) with PEI 5 abrasion resistance and ≥1300 N breaking strength withstand high footfall and luggage cart loads.
  • Logistics Warehouses: Full-body porcelain tiles for heavy-duty industrial floors resist impact and abrasion; slab sizes reduce grout lines, lowering maintenance.
  • Hospitals & Educational Facilities: Antibacterial wall tiles and easy-clean porcelain surfaces help meet hygiene standards; frost-resistant outdoor tiles suit campus pathways.
  • Shopping Malls & Hotel Lobbies: Marble and Travertine series provide high-end aesthetics with PEI 4/5 durability, reducing refurbishment frequency.
